The Baby Expo will be in the Mother City from 30 October to 1 November 2009 at the Cape Town International Convention Centre.
The Baby Expo creates the perfect environment to learn about pregnancy, being a great parent and building a wholesome, active lifestyle for your family, all while having a fun day out.
Barney, the world’s best loved dinosaur will be appearing at The Cape Town Baby Expo 2009. As the only exhibition in South Africa to hold live Barney performances, The Cape Town Baby Expo is the place to be for Barney lovers of all ages. Remember that should you wish to attend one of the Barney & Friends shows at no extra cost, you would need to reserve your seat when purchasing your entrance tickets for The Baby Expo Cape Town.
Barney has many friends and seats are limited, so book your seats now to avoid missing out on one of the greatest kids shows. Seating is unreserved and entrance to the Barney & Friends Show will open approximately 30 minutes before the show starts.
The Kids Kitchen is a new feature that will be launched at The Baby Expo 2009. The fully functional kitchen will include a working area, kids demo area and visitor seating. The area will be a continuous hub of activity, in a semi-enclosed casual environment, with live food demos and nutritional workshops.
Breastfeeding is a private and quiet time, and an opportunity for mum and baby to bond. This is why private rooms for mums to feed their babies will be available. There will also be bottle warming stations for mums to warm up their little one's bottles while on the run.
The Baby Expo Cape Town knows what it’s like to be a parent on the go, and so Pampers have set up rooms with nappy changing in mind. These rooms take away the stressful queues of restrooms, and provide a spot where you can change your baby quickly and comfortably.
Healthy kids are always full of energy, so there will be a playground for kids. This is a great chance for your kids to play and interact with other children, and learn to share and make friends. It is fully monitored by child minders so that mum and dad can relax while the kids have fun.
Expose yourself to workshops designed to help make life easier and also to educate and inform you so you can be an even better superhero than you already are. Workshops on play therapy, sleeping habits, parenting tips and so much more will be offered to parents this year.
The Baby Expo has invited a number of key speakers to address parents at the expo and booking is not required. However seating is limited, and it is suggested that you come early to avoid disappointment. The experts are well known and respected within their various industries and are looking forward to chatting with you at the expos.
